
About This Property
Roeser Senior Village contains 80 low-income units in Phoenix, Arizona, serving elderly residents with a mix of 25 studio and 57 one-bedroom apartments. The property was placed in service in 2002 and utilizes 9% Low-Income Housing Tax Credits. A non-profit organization owns the community.
Waitlist Information
Waitlist managed by City of Phoenix Housing Department
Applicants must notify COPHD of any changes in address, phone, email, or family members within 10 business days to avoid removal from the waitlist if notifications are not returned or information is out of date. Only one pre-application per household is accepted; duplicate forms will be removed.
The Phoenix Housing Choice Voucher (HCV) program waiting list is currently closed. The City of Phoenix will provide notice through a wide variety of sources when it reopens.

Property Details
Fair Market Rent - Maricopa County, AZ
FMR represents the estimated amount needed to cover rent and utilities for a moderately-priced unit in this area.
| Bedrooms | FMR |
|---|---|
| Studio/Efficiency | $1,460 |
| 1 Bedroom | $1,599 |
| 2 Bedroom | $1,877 |
| 3 Bedroom | $2,541 |
| 4 Bedroom | $2,890 |

| Household | Extremely Low (30%) | Very Low (50%) | Low (80%) |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 Person | $16,600 | $27,650 | $44,250 |
| 2 Persons | $19,000 | $31,600 | $50,600 |
| 3 Persons | $21,960 | $35,550 | $56,900 |
| 4 Persons | $26,500 | $39,500 | $63,200 |
| 5 Persons | $31,040 | $42,700 | $68,300 |
| 6 Persons | $35,580 | $45,850 | $73,350 |
| 7 Persons | $40,120 | $49,000 | $78,400 |
| 8 Persons | $44,660 | $52,150 | $83,450 |
